New Denham Town homeowners warned against fire hazards

  • fave
  • like
  • share

WITH MORE than 500 residents of the Kingston Western constituency rendered homeless by fire in the last six years, four families who received keys to houses in Denham Town have been warned against the hazard of stealing electricity.

Local Government and Community Development Minister Desmond McKenzie said during yesterday’s handover of keys that the beneficiaries were among families who had suffered loss of their homes to fire as recent as a year ago.

McKenzie, who is also member of parliament for Kingston Western, where the Elgin Street houses are located, warned the owners of the brand new homes that they might be evicted for violations such as the illegal abstraction of electricity and water.

“Since the year started, we have had over 10 major fires in the constituency.”

Recipient of one of the homes, Monique Francis, said that she was displaced by fire nine years ago but only received a call recently that she would be a beneficiary.
